Not Getting Developmental Milestones

Parents can be concerned when their child's development isn't progressing as they would expect. Talk to your doctor before you take any action.

Each child has their own growth rate and development. Each child is unique from the other. Milestones are a common way used by professionals to assess what is normal at certain age groups. However, there is a wide range when it comes to milestones such as walking, crawling, potty training and birth injury case even speaking. A lot of children meet these standards within a normal time while others may take longer to reach them or avoid them altogether.

If a child does not reach milestones in their development, it could be an indication that they are suffering from issues with their mental or physical health. The good news is that in most cases, missed milestones can be addressed by working with a skilled therapist. The kind of rehabilitation the child will receive is contingent on the milestone they missed, the seriousness of the missing milestone as well as the root cause. Lifelong Care

The most severe birth injuries could cause a child to be permanently disabled, which is extremely distressing for parents and families. The medical bills are also immense for the treatments and therapies that will last for the rest of their lives. The medical professional who is negligent and who caused the injury could be obligated to pay the costs in a successful medical malpractice lawsuit.

A skilled birth trauma lawyer has access to experts who can help prove that the negligent medical professional violated their obligation to provide appropriate treatment during labor and delivery and caused the injury. This is vital to ensure that you receive the highest amount of compensation for your family.

The improper use of medical instruments, such as vacuum extractors, forceps and Pitocin, can lead to various injuries. This includes nerve damage, spinal cord and brain injuries. Insufficient oxygen levels during childbirth can also lead to permanent injury, and the negligent medical professionals who cause this should be held accountable.
